Business Analyst
Make your application after reading the following skill and qualification requirements for this position.
Location: Bristol 2/3 days p/w
Salary: £50,000
We are looking for a confident and communicative Business Analyst to join a growing organisation based in Bristol. This is a central role, bridging the gap between the business and IT teams, with a particular focus on improving systems and enabling better use of technology.
You will collaborate closely with .NET development teams to define and deliver practical solutions that support business needs. Strong communication, analytical thinking, and stakeholder engagement are vital for success in this role.
Key Responsibilities:
Act as a liaison between business users and technical teams
Translate business needs into clear, actionable requirements
Work with developers to support system enhancements and new features
Lead workshops and meetings with key stakeholders
Help ensure solutions are fit for purpose and support wider business objectives Key Skills and Experience:
Demonstrable experience as a Business Analyst within a tech-driven setting
Strong knowledge of software development processes, particularly within Microsoft/.NET environments
Excellent interpersonal and stakeholder engagement skills
Ability to work across both technical and business-focused teams
Methodical, proactive, and commercially aware approach to problem-solving This is a fantastic role for someone eager to make a direct impact on system performance and user experience, working at the heart of change
